Output 34240665c8617e914bd84805bccdeaae9463330aed39d5c2b7d7041d964f4f84:2

value
531214
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 117267bbb5d6b9a4219cddf693495e3e298e3ab6 OP_EQUALVERIFY OP_CHECKSIG
address
12bFYGupmMkG73TmozTkm88KfMErycfeUa
transaction
34240665c8617e914bd84805bccdeaae9463330aed39d5c2b7d7041d964f4f84